Output 707d0db31b08623850226f87c50fc3bb825ef1dfd8d3fd89a769834d0a1518d8:4

value
66256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70cd81d2346ca98db18981f7c9609e8b3d6a3276 OP_EQUAL
address
3ByTnuvkmSxNLTjt274JXZGUqgYcuDZg9D
transaction
707d0db31b08623850226f87c50fc3bb825ef1dfd8d3fd89a769834d0a1518d8
spent
true